WebNov 18, 2024 · Tolbooth Steeple (1634) Built by Glasgow architect and Master of Works, John Boyd, the Tolbooth Steeple has kept watch over Glasgow Cross for nigh on 500 years. The Tolbooth itself was demolished ... WebThis was the 17th Century equivalent of the City Chambers. The building, finished in 1627, marked the arrival of the merchant classes to the city and housed the town clerk's office, council hall and city prison. The Debtors Prison had a stream of inmates who elected their own provost and generally ran the place themselves. Witches, thieves and murderers were …
